QuickLogic has received $6.5m in its fourth tranche of funding from the US Department of Defense (DoD) for its radiation hard FPGA programme.

The funding will support the continued development and demonstration of Strategic Radiation Hardened (SRH) high reliability Field Programmable Gate Array (FPGA) technology. The initiative aims to meet current and future DoD strategic and space system requirements.

“To date we have now been awarded over $33 million. This project exemplifies our steadfast commitment to delivering innovative FPGA technology tailored to meet the rigorous demands of the Aerospace and Defense Industrial Base (DIB) and will extend our capabilities to support SRH design objectives,” said Brian Faith, President and CEO of QuickLogic.
